About this book

This vintage book contains a complete handbook of sewing, with information on all aspects ranging from altering patterns to fastening buttons. Written in plain language and full of helpful tips, "The Complete Book of Sewing" constitutes a must-have for anyone with an interest in sewing, and would make for a worthy addition to the family collection. Contents include: "Choosing the right Clothes", "How to Choose the Right Fabrics", "Sewing Tools and How to Make them Work For You", "Seams", "Darts, Tucks and Pleats", "Gathers, Ruffles, and Headings", "Hems, Facing, Bindings", "Embroidery Anu Appliqué", "Time-Saving Measurement Routines", etc. Many vintage books such as this are becoming increasingly scarce and expensive.
